The television played another children’s programme as Ben sat watching; unmoving and unseeing on the sofa. Julie tidied the room around him singing along with the make believe characters as they followed the petty plot of sharing a toy through to the end of the show. As soon as one finished the next one started and she took no notice of the change, still singing the same song. The phone rang and disturbed her singing.
‘Hello?’
‘Is that Julie?’ A woman was on the other end of the line, concern oozed through her speech, the underlying emotion clear to all.
‘Who’s speaking?’
‘My names Louise, I’m calling from the nursery. We haven’t seen Ben for a few days and you hadn’t called to let us know that he wouldn’t be in. Is he okay?’
‘Oh sorry, he’s a little under the weather. I’m going to keep him off until he perks up a little.’
The worry dropped from Louise’s voice.
‘As long as he’s okay.’
Julie nodded, funny the other woman couldn’t see her but the reassurance was there.
‘Yes thank you.’
